Union, N.J. (4/24/18) – The Kean University baseball team completed their non-conference schedule with a win against Drew University on Tuesday by the final of 8-5.
Senior Matt Krupa was 2-for-4 with two RBI and a run scored as Kean improved to 18-18 overall. The loss drops the Rangers to 15-15 this season. They were led by Brent Lincoln who was 2-for-3 with three RBI.
The Cougars fell behind 4-1 as Drew plated two runs in the first and two more in the third. Kean tied things up with a three spot in the fourth. Krupa got the ball rolling with a single, he later scored on a double steal. Freshman Zach Joe singled home Nick Polizzano and Joe moved around the bases on an errant pickoff throw, a stolen base and a passed ball, putting the score at four-all.
Kean took the lead in the fifth on an RBI double from Krupa and a sacrifice fly from Polizzano.
Joe was 2-for-4 with an RBI and two runs scored while Tim Huxen was 1-for-2 with three runs scored.
Derek Walker (2-0) earned the win in relief. He allowed one earned run and two hits in three and a third innings of work. Kyle Gaeb earned his second save of the season with a one-two-three ninth frame.
Kean returns to NJAC action on Thursday when they travel to Rutgers-Camden.
